Meniscus

Written by the Fiveable Content Team • Last updated August 2025
Written by the Fiveable Content Team • Last updated August 2025

Definition

A meniscus is a C-shaped piece of tough, rubbery cartilage that acts as a shock absorber within certain synovial joints, such as the knee. It helps to cushion the joint and distribute loads evenly across the joint surfaces.
